About
Dr. Chih-Cheng Chang is a pioneer in the intersection of robotics, human-robot interaction, and musical cognition. His research centers on developing autonomous robots capable of reading, interpreting, and performing music—a field that bridges engineering with the arts. Dr. Chang’s most significant contribution is the creation of face robots and two-wheeled robots that can autonomously read simplified musical notation and sing with vocal synthesis, enabling novel forms of human-robot interaction. His seminal work, "A face robot for autonomous simplified musical notation reading and singing" (2011, 18 citations), demonstrates a robotic head with artificial facial skin that not only sings but also expresses emotions through facial expressions, enhancing communicative realism. Earlier foundational studies, such as "The realization of a music reading and singing two-wheeled robot" (2007, 5 citations), introduced a musical notation editor that allows users to create hardcopy songs for direct robot interaction. Dr. Chang’s innovative approach has laid groundwork for expressive, autonomous robots in entertainment, education, and assistive technologies, making him a notable figure in socially interactive robotics.
